| #include "base/scheduler_stub.h" |
| |
| #include "testing/base/public/gunit.h" |
| |
| namespace mozc { |
| namespace { |
| |
| static int g_counter = 0; |
| static bool g_result = true; |
| |
| bool TestFunc(void *data) { |
| ++g_counter; |
| return g_result; |
| } |
| |
| class SchedulerStubTest : public ::testing::Test { |
| protected: |
| virtual void SetUp() { |
| g_counter = 0; |
| g_result = true; |
| } |
| |
| virtual void TearDown() { |
| g_counter = 0; |
| g_result = true; |
| } |
| }; |
| |
| TEST_F(SchedulerStubTest, AddRemoveJob) { |
| SchedulerStub scheduler_stub; |
| scheduler_stub.AddJob(Scheduler::JobSetting( |
| "Test", 1000, 100000, 5000, 0, &TestFunc, NULL)); |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); // delay_start |
| EXPECT_EQ(1, g_counter); |
| |
| scheduler_stub.PutClockForward(1000); // default_interval |
| EXPECT_EQ(2, g_counter); |
| |
| scheduler_stub.PutClockForward(1000); // default_interval |
| EXPECT_EQ(3, g_counter); |
| |
| scheduler_stub.RemoveJob("Test");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(3,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(3, g_counter); |
| } |

| TEST_F(SchedulerStubTest, BackOff) { |
| SchedulerStub scheduler_stub; |
| scheduler_stub.AddJob(Scheduler::JobSetting( |
| "Test", 1000, 6000, 3000, 0, &TestFunc, NULL)); |
| g_result = false; |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); // delay_start |
| EXPECT_EQ(1, g_counter); |
| |
| scheduler_stub.PutClockForward(1000); // backoff (wait 1000 + 1000) |
| EXPECT_EQ(1,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(2, g_counter); |
| |
| scheduler_stub.PutClockForward(1000); // backoff (wait 1000 + 1000 * 2) |
| EXPECT_EQ(2,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(2,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(3, g_counter); |
| |
| scheduler_stub.PutClockForward(1000); // backoff (wait 1000 + 1000 * 4) |
| EXPECT_EQ(3,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(3,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(3,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(3,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(4, g_counter); |
| |
| // backoff (wait 1000 + 1000 * 8) > 6000, use same delay |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(4,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(4,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(4,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(4,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(5, g_counter); |
| |
| g_result = true; |
| |
| // use same delay |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(5,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(5,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(5,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(5,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(6, g_counter); |
| |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(7, g_counter);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(8, g_counter); |
| } |

| TEST_F(SchedulerStubTest, AddRemoveJobs) { |
| SchedulerStub scheduler_stub; |
| scheduler_stub.AddJob(Scheduler::JobSetting( |
| "Test1", 1000, 100000, 1000, 0, &TestFunc, NULL)); |
| EXPECT_EQ(0, g_counter); |
| scheduler_stub.PutClockForward(1000); // delay |
| EXPECT_EQ(1, g_counter); |
| |
| scheduler_stub.AddJob(Scheduler::JobSetting( |
| "Test2", 1000, 100000, 1000, 0, &TestFunc, NULL)); |
| |
| scheduler_stub.PutClockForward(1000); // delay + interval |
| EXPECT_EQ(3, g_counter); |
| |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(5, g_counter); |
| |
| scheduler_stub.RemoveJob("Test3"); // nothing happens |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(7, g_counter); |
| |
| scheduler_stub.RemoveJob("Test2");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(8, g_counter); |
| |
| scheduler_stub.RemoveAllJobs(); |
| scheduler_stub.PutClockForward(1000); |
| EXPECT_EQ(8, g_counter); |
| } |
| } // namespace |
| } // namespace mozc |
